The Smar LD301 Pressure Transmitter is a reliable device engineered for precise pressure measurement in demanding industrial environments. Featuring robust construction and a 4-20mA output, the LD301 ensures seamless integration into your existing automation systems.

Crafted from high-quality 316L Sst and filled with silicone oil, this pressure transmitter is designed to withstand harsh conditions and provide consistent performance. With a pressure rating of 2300 Psi and IP67 protection, the Smar LD301 offers exceptional durability and accuracy. The 12-42 Vdc supply range adds to its flexibility in various setups. Specifications:
Output: 4-20mA
Supply Range: 12-42 Vdc
Pressure Rating: 2300 Psi
Protection: IP67
Material: 316L Sst
